5x+4=-41 answer? explain!!

Answer:

x = -9

Step-by-step explanation:

5x + 4 = -41   Your goal is to get x alone on on side

     - 4    - 4   Subtract 4 from both sides to get 5x alone

5x = -45  Now you need to divide to get what x equals

\frac{5x}{5} = \frac{-45}{5}  Divide by 5 to get x

x = -9

Identify whether the expressions are equivalent or not equivalent: 11(p + q) and 11p + (7q + 4q)
Stella [2.4K]

Answer:

Yes they are

Step-by-step explanation:

11(p+q) = 11p + 11q

---------------------------

11p + (7q+ 4q)

= 11p + ( q * (7+4))

= 11p + (q * 11)

= 11p+ 11q

See they are the same
